The treatment of inflammatory pulmonary nodules has the following two main aspects: 1. To confirm the diagnosis, pulmonary nodules belong to the imaging concept, which refers to round-like high-density lesions less than 3 cm in diameter found on lung imaging. Inflammatory nodules refer to nodules produced by inflammatory stimuli, including those caused by acute inflammation and chronic inflammation, as well as those caused by infectious inflammation and non-specific inflammation, of which those caused by infectious inflammation are the most common. 2, for different types of inflammatory pulmonary nodules to take different treatment plans, if it is chronic inflammatory stimulation of the granuloma, and does not produce any symptoms and harm to the human body, do not need to be treated. If the inflammatory nodule is caused by a bacterial infection, effective antibiotics such as cephalosporins or penicillins can be used. If the inflammatory nodule is caused by a fungal infection, antifungal treatment such as fluconazole or itraconazole is required. If the inflammatory nodules are caused by parasitic infections, antiparasitic treatment is required.
